Transaction a76519f422d9abaf5a8679caa82f1e93f1b39f918878b5893a44f456ea432597
1 Input
2 Outputs
- a76519f422d9abaf5a8679caa82f1e93f1b39f918878b5893a44f456ea432597:0
- a76519f422d9abaf5a8679caa82f1e93f1b39f918878b5893a44f456ea432597:1
value 19060
address 1PfDfKdDKPfHNSzyRNQVgN3PAeCgU4HJiM
value 670158
address 1AwkiwXWSK7DpAvW3oez9eWLuiQD11PwE8